2. Iimpawu zokukhusela ezibalaseleyo zokubanjwa kwe-zinc oxide
I-Zinc oxide arrester iyimveliso yombane esetyenziselwa ukukhusela izixhobo zombane ezahlukeneyo kwinkqubo yamandla kumonakalo we-overvoltage, kwaye inokhuseleko olwenziweyo. Ngenxa yokuba uphawu lwe-volt-ampere ye-volt-ampere yeplate ye-zinc oxide yeplate ilunge kakhulu, ukuze kuphela ikhulu le-microampere yangoku idlule phantsi kwamandla ombane aqhelekileyo, kulula ukuyila isakhiwo esingenasiphelo, ukuze ikhuseleke kakuhle ukusebenza, ubunzima bokukhanya, kunye nobukhulu obuncinci. uphawu. Xa umbane ongaphezulu kwamandla ungena, ukuhamba ngoku kwipleyiti yevalve kukhula ngokukhawuleza, kwaye kwangaxeshanye ubungakanani bevolthi ephezulu bunqunyelwe, kwaye amandla ombane ongaphezulu ayakhululwa. Emva koko, ipleyiti ye-zinc oxide valve ibuyela kwimeko yokuchasana okuphezulu, ukuze inkqubo yamandla isebenze ngokwesiqhelo.

5. Ukusebenza kokucocwa kakuhle kwe-zinc oxide arrester
Isikhuseli esingenasiphelo se-zinc oxide arrester sinokumelana nongcoliseko oluphezulu.
Inqanaba langoku lomgama wokuhamba oxelwe ngumgangatho kazwelonke ngu:
Indawo yeClass II yongcoliseko oluphakathi: umgama wokuthambeka 20mm / kv
Inqanaba lommandla we-III ungcoliseko olunzima: umgama wokuthambeka 25mm / kv
⑶ IBakala IV, indawo enzima kakhulu yongcoliseko: umgama wokuthambeka 31mm / kv
